Install the drain fitting and the drain hose
Use bolts to secure the unit to a flat, solid floor.
Condensation is produced and flows from the outdoor unit when the appliance is operating in the
heating mode. In order not to disturb neighbors and to respect the environment,install a drain fitting
and a drain hose to channel the condensate water. Install the drain fitting and rubber washer on the
outdoor unit chassis and connect a drain hose to it as shown in the figure.

NOTE: As for the shape of drainage joint, please refer to the current product. Do not install the drainage
joint in the severe cold area. Otherwise, it will be frosted and then cause malfunction.

Post-installation checks

Has the unit been installed securely?
Is the thermal insulation of the pipes sufficient?
Has the check for gas leaks been executed?
Does the water drain properly?
Does the supply voltage match the voltage indicated on
the data plate?
Have the piping and electrical wiring been installed
correctly?
Has the unit been properly earthed?
Does the power cable meet requirements?
Are there any obstructions at the air inlet or outlet?
Have the dust and other particles produced during
installation been removed?
Are the gas valve and liquid valve of the connecting tube
fully open?
Have the length of the refrigerating tube and the amount
of the refrigerant charge been registered?
